Wernicke encephalopathy after obesity surgery: a systematic review.
OBJECTIVE To characterize the clinical features, risk factors, radiographic findings, and prognosis of Wernicke encephalopathy after bariatric surgery. METHODS We performed a systematic review of MEDLINE, Embase, Ovid, ISI (Science Citation Index), and Google Scholar for case reports, case series, or cohort studies of Wernicke encephalopathy after bariatric surgery. متن کاملThiamine deficiency after bariatric surgery may lead to Wernicke encephalopathy.
Of special note are neurological complications, which manifest at 3 to 20 months after bariatric surgery and all affect patients experiencing prolonged vomiting. The neurological symptoms include chronic and subacute peripheral neuropathy, acute peripheral neuropathy, burning feet, meralgia paresthetica, myotonic syndrome, posterolateral myelopathy, and Wernicke encephalopathy [1]. متن کاملWernicke Korsakoff Encephalopathy
Carl Wernicke described first Wernicke encephalopathy in 1881. He reported a pathological clinical situation, which comprises a triad of symptoms with acute mental confusion, ataxia, and ophthalmoplegia.
